Introduction and Its Compliance
EPFO (Employees' Provident Fund Organisation) Registration is a mandatory requirement under the Employees’ Provident Fund and Miscellaneous Provisions Act, 1952. It applies to those establishments who have employed 20 or more staff and aims to secure their long-term financial welfare by providing retirement benefits, pension and insurance. Benefits and Advantages
- Retirement Savings for Employees It ensures that employees build a retirement corpus through monthly contributions, supporting their financial stability after they leave employment.
- Tax Benefits for Employers and Employees Contributions made to EPF accounts are eligible for tax deductions under the Income Tax Act, benefiting both employees and employers.
- Financial Assistance in Emergencies EPF can be partially withdrawn in specific situations such as medical emergencies, marriage or education, offering much-needed liquidity.
- Improved Employee Retention A structured PF scheme increases trust and loyalty, helping organizations retain skilled and experienced workers.
- Legal Compliance and Reputation Being EPFO-compliant protects businesses from legal penalties and enhances their reputation in the eyes of employees and authorities.
Eligibility Criteria
- Establishments with 20 or more employees are mandatorily required to register.
- Companies with fewer employees may also opt for voluntary registration.
- All employees earning less than ₹15,000/month must be compulsorily covered.
- Organizations from sectors such as manufacturing, trading, services and IT are eligible.
Documents Required
- PAN Card of the company/firm
- Certificate of Incorporation or registration under Shop & Establishment Act
- Address proof of the business
- Details of all employees (Aadhar, PAN, salary, date of joining, etc.)
- Bank details of the company
- Digital Signature Certificate (DSC) of the authorized signatory
- Specimen signature of authorized personnel
- Cancelled cheque of the company’s bank account

Penalties
- Delay in EPF registration can lead to a penalty of ₹5,000 or more.
- Late deposit of contributions attracts interest at 12% p.a. and damages up to 25% depending on the delay period.
- Failure to register eligible employees may result in legal prosecution.

Timelines
Standard Processing Time
The EPFO registration process typically takes 7 to 10 working days, provided all required documents and details are accurate and complete.
Timelines may vary depending on document verification and government approvals.
